WebJul 3, 2024 · Dust furniture before washing in a solution of mild detergent and water. Avoid using ground water that may contain sulfur, iron oxide or other minerals that can stain the furniture. Rinse and dry ... WebMake sure the surface is clean, apply the rust remover or acid (following the instructions and safety precautions on the bottle), let it sit for five to 10 minutes, then scrub and rinse. WebApr 5, 2024 · For this step, all you need to do is fill a bucket with warm water and mix in a few drops of any type of dish soap. 2. Use a Rag to Clean the Surface. Make sure you use a lint-free rag to wash the surface of your furniture. Using a rag with lint on it can make it more difficult to adequately clean the surface.
